The Free Dictionary WebA bachelor of fine arts (BFA) degree allows students time to focus on and perfect their skills in their preferred artistic medium. In a BFA program, students study classical and modern art and learn to paint, draw, sculpt, carve, render, and model in traditional—rather than digital—formats. To obtain a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ree at a university, college or art school, it typically takes four years of full-time study, taking four classes each semester. Different states and institutions have their own graduation requirements for Fine Arts degrees. Even within a university, college or art school, the requirements ... The USC School of Dramatic Arts is not ... WebTisch Drama offers a Bachelor of Fine Arts Degree in Theatre. Candidates for the degree must fulfill the following requirements: A minimum of 48 credits of Professional Training. A minimum of 28 credits of Theatre Studies. A minimum of 32 credits of General Education. A minimum of 20 credits of Electives. Students should finish with enough ...
